Thank you for contacting me to share your support for the Appalachia Restoration Act (S. 696). It is an honor to serve as your Senator, and I appreciate hearing from you.

I, too, support this legislation because mountaintop removal mining is an irreversibly destructive practice. By using explosives to remove the tops of mountains to access coal, and then burying valleys and streams with the waste material, mountaintop removal mining destroys forests and watersheds, endangering communities' water quality and public health. I believe our country must move away from these mining practices and instead embrace a clean energy future built on energy efficiency and renewable energy.

The Appalachia Restoration Act would amend the Clean Water Act to prevent the dumping of mining waste into streams, effectively ending the practice of mountaintop removal mining. This bill has been referred to the Senate Environment and Public Works Committee for future action.
